We never really know what is going to change our lives, it could be anything at any given moment. Oftentimes a very challenging and difficult situation becomes the catalyst for a change of trajectory in our life, and only later, looking back, can we understand its importance and be grateful for it. Have you ever experienced such grace in a situation that seemed negative at first sight? In this fifth podcast we will share with you two such stories, ones that enclose the bitter-then-sweet taste of remarkable lessons brought to us by teachers and life, that began looking difficult but ended up being gems in and for our journey. You will learn: How Marina found herself in a Thai monastery in the middle of nowhere, In which ways the mysterious word the Buddhist nun kept repeating to her, -“Iddappacayata”, which means interconnectedness of life- has changed her life completely. What Misha found in an $18 Byron Katie’s book that has shown him the real world, And why a long-term MBA-training for $ 250,000 cannot compete with Byron’s lessons. Marina and Misha will share with you what they’ve discovered -and keep discovering- thank to those crucial moments. You will also learn how to distort your understanding of life in order not to distort reality. Interesting? The answers are waiting for you in this episode.
